Wego Chemical Group is a global distributor and sourcing partner of chemicals and ingredients. We are an established player in the global specialty chemical markets, providing end-use manufacturers across industries in North America, LATAM, & EMEA with end-to-end supply chain solutions from across the globe. Our team has been operating for over 45 years, serving customers in over 25 countries, with 200+ professionals in 9 offices strategically located across 4 continents. Wego is family owned and operated, with 3 members of ownership across 2 generations actively serving in leadership as CEO, COO, and CCO.
Job Summary
For our US HQ in Great Neck, we are looking to hire a Payroll Analyst to process payroll and maintain the employee database regarding salary and pay. The candidate will also ensure accuracy and timely completion of all commission processing and play a critical role in the day-to-day operations of the company, interacting daily with vendors, staff and the Finance, HR and Commercial team.
The ideal candidate is Payroll professional with corporate experience in finance operations; someone with a builder mindset, strong detail orientation, excited by a project, ready to roll up their sleeves and wear many hats, and excited to make a high impact in a fast-growing organization.
Responsibilities- Check timesheets for accuracy for all employees in the US.
- Review Fresh Service Employee ticketing and adjust pay for raises, bonuses and commissions.
- Process Bi-weekly payroll for US employee with Insperity and Process 401K with Fidelity
- Coordinate payment of international employees globally thru global payroll provider/Regional Controllers
- Ensure timely and accurate payment for all employee and respond to all inquiries.
- Process commission payments for sales teams based on sales compensation plans.
- Address and resolve inquiries from sales personnel regarding commission payouts.
